What degree comes first?

List of College Degrees in Order

Degree Order Degree Type Program Duration
Undergraduate Associate’s degree 2 years
Undergraduate Bachelor’s degree 4 years
Graduate Master’s degree 1-2 years
Graduate Doctoral degree 5-7 years

Can I get a job with a 3.0 GPA?

A: Some elite employers have policies requiring a certain GPA (usually a 3.0 or higher), and there is generally no way around that rule. In some cases you can squeak through by demonstrating that you’ve achieved better grades in your particular major or in classes related to the job to which you’re applying.

Should I put a 3.2 GPA on my resume?

While there’s no clear-cut rule that dictates when to include your GPA, most career experts say to only keep it on a resume if it’s over 3.5.

Does Google care about GPA?

Google doesn’t even ask for GPA or test scores from candidates anymore, unless someone’s a year or two out of school, because they don’t correlate at all with success at the company. Even for new grads, the correlation is slight, the company has found.

What GPA do you need for Google?

Officially, there is no minimum requirement for GPA if you want to be considered for an internship or full-time position at Google. However, you’d be best advised to have a score of at least 3.0 to avoid any awkward questions that you might not be able to answer to their satisfaction.

Is a 3.7 GPA good for investment banking?

A GPA of a 3.7+ can make up for weaker experience, but is by no means a gimme. Banks prefer good experience to good GPAs (subject to a minimum in the 3.3-3.5 range).

What GPA does Goldman Sachs require?

The most important thing on your résumé is your GPA. Your grade point average is “the first thing you look at on the résumé,” the former analyst said. And it should be 3.6, preferable 3.7 or higher.

What GPA do I need for Goldman Sachs?

U.S. students joining Goldman Sachs and JPM, may not be the very, very brightest, but they’re still incredibly bright. The average GPA at each firm was at least 3.72 (93%).

Is a 3.7 GPA good WSO?

Anything above a 3.5 is considered good and above a 3.7 is impressive. Keep in mind that your GPA doesn’t make up your entire resume. You could potentially break in with a 2.8 GPA, but that is the exception, not the rule. You really want to aim for a 3.7+ GPA with strong extracurricular activities.
